火狐firefox提示“内容编码错误 无法显示您尝试查看的页面,因为它使用了无效或者不支持的压缩格式。”

火狐firefox浏览器打开网也是时提示“内容编码错误 无法显示您尝试查看的页面,因为它使用了无效或者不支持的压缩格式。”

今早一来打开用PHPCMS做的网站时就提示这个错误,用其他浏览器打开提示的是无法打开,用火狐浏览器则提示以上文字,话说火狐还真是个好东西,很多错误其它浏览器不会提示因而不好找到正确的解决方法,在这里先给火狐来个赞。

下面说说这个问题的原因及解决方法:

原因:

经检测,出现此问题的原因是因为服务器关闭了gzip压缩导致的,而我的程序使用了gzip压缩。导致程序执行gzip压缩时压缩不成功,当浏览器请求该页面时返回的代码不能被浏览器正确的使用gzip解压,所以造成了网站打不开。

解决方法:

1、去服务器开启gzip压缩服务;

2、关闭网站程序的gzip。

因为没有服务器的操作权限,所以我选择第二种方法(这个网站是PHPcms,讲下怎么关闭PHPcms的gzip,其他程序因物而意,方法都差不多):

打开:网站根目录/caches/configs/system.php

大约37行,将gzip的值改为0

到此,问题解决。

下次如果要开启gzip就把值改为1

上一篇:KVO - 键值观察


下一篇:RecyclerView添加头部和底部视图的实现方法